Bile Peng is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Aerospace Engineering and Signal Processing. According to data from OpenAlex, Bile Peng has authored 39 papers receiving a total of 1.0k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 34 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ering, 12 papers in Aerospace Engineering and 7 papers in Signal Processing. Recurrent topics in Bile Peng’s work include Millimeter-Wave Propagation and Modeling (24 papers), Advanced MIMO Systems Optimization (19 papers) and Microwave Engineering and Waveguides (10 papers). Bile Peng is often cited by papers focused on Millimeter-Wave Propagation and Modeling (24 papers), Advanced MIMO Systems Optimization (19 papers) and Microwave Engineering and Waveguides (10 papers). Bile Peng collaborates with scholars based in Germany, China and Sweden. Bile Peng's co-authors include Thomas Kürner, Zhangdui Zhong, Ke Guan, Danping He, Bo Ai, Sebastian Rey, Henk Wymeersch, Guangkai Li, Johannes M. Eckhardt and Ke Guan and has published in prestigious journals such as IEEE Access, IEEE Transactions on Communications and IEEE Transactions on Wireless Communications.
